How to Make Meaty Stuffed Manicotti

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C).
  2. Cook 1 pound manicotti pasta according to package directions until al dente. Rinse with cold water and drain thoroughly.
  3. Remove casings from 1 pound Italian sausage and discard. In a large skillet, brown the sausage and 1 pound ground beef over medium-high heat, breaking it up with a spoon, until no longer pink. Drain off any excess grease.
  4. In a large bowl, whisk together 2 large eggs and 1/2 cup milk.
  5. Add 1 (10-ounce) package of frozen chopped spinach, thawed and squeezed dry, 1 (15-ounce) container of ricotta cheese, 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ese, 1 teaspoon dried oregano, 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der, 1/4 teaspoon salt, and 1/4 teaspoon black pepper to the egg mixture.
  6. Stir in the cooked sausage and beef mixture and 2 cups shredded mozzarella cheese.
  7. Spoon the filling into the manicotti shells. Arrange the filled shells in a lightly greased 13x9 inch baking dish.
  8. Pour 1 (24-ounce) jar of your favorite spaghetti sauce evenly over the manicotti.
  9. Bake, covered, for 30 minutes.
  10. Uncover and pour the remaining 1 (24-ounce) jar of spaghetti sauce over the manicotti.
  11. Sprinkle with 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ese.
  12. Bake, uncovered, for an additional 10-15 minutes, or until the sauce is bubbly and the cheese is golden brown.
